Shares of Robinhood Markets Inc. (HOOD) are surging 5.03% in pre-market trading on Thursday, as investors react positively to the company's expanding cryptocurrency offerings and potential growth in tokenization. The stock's upward momentum comes amid a series of bullish developments for the popular trading platform.

In a recent podcast interview, Robinhood CEO Vlad Tenev highlighted the company's vision for cryptocurrency and tokenization. Tenev suggested that if crypto includes the tokenization of real-world assets like stocks, it could become a significant revenue driver for Robinhood. This strategic direction aligns with the company's recent launch of blockchain-powered tokenized equities for its European customers, signaling Robinhood's commitment to innovation in the fintech space.

Adding to the positive sentiment, Robinhood announced the listing of FLOKI spot trading, further expanding its cryptocurrency offerings. This move is likely to attract more crypto enthusiasts to the platform and diversify its revenue streams. The expansion in crypto comes at a time when Robinhood reported that its crypto revenue nearly doubled year-over-year in the second quarter, accounting for 30% of its overall transaction-based revenue. As the company continues to capitalize on the growing interest in digital assets, investors appear optimistic about its future growth prospects in this sector.
